“He loved basketball & was good enough to be recruited to play college ball. But during his junior year, a boy on his team was shot & killed. Boseman coped w/ the tragedy by writing a play in response to the incident, which he called Crossroads & staged at his high school.”
“He realized he liked telling stories. ‘I just had a feeling that this was something that was calling me,’ he says.” https://web.archive.org/web/20180225052231/https://www.rollingstone.com/movies/features/black-panther-chadwick-boseman-ryan-coogler-cover-story-w516853
One of his first jobs, in 2003, was on the soap opera All My Children. He was fired after one week for voicing concerns about the racial stereotypes of his character: “I was like, This is not part of my manifesto. This is not part of what I want to do.” https://www.thewrap.com/black-panther-chadwick-boseman-michael-b-jordan-all-my-children-soap-played-same-role-fired/
“I remember going home and thinking, ‘Do I say something to them about this? Do I just do it?’ And I couldn’t just do it. I had to voice my opinions & put my stamp on it. And the good thing about it was, it changed it a little bit.”
In 2005 his play, Deep Azure, which began as a poem, was produced in Chicago
The artist statement he wrote about the play https://www.press.umich.edu/special/hiphop/deep_azure
“He always looked for projects that had the same emotional weight he felt when he was 17 and a bullet took his friend and inspired his first play.

‘For me, doing this, it has to be meaningful,’ Boseman says. ‘Because that's how it started.’” https://web.archive.org/web/20180225052231/https://www.rollingstone.com/movies/features/black-panther-chadwick-boseman-ryan-coogler-cover-story-w516853#
